After Much searching, this was the best overall deal on the resin I found - at the beginner volume, to see if you like working with it.
The cost does not drop significantly until you go up in quantity of purchase to a gallon or more. (Ie, a gallon costs $64. = $0.50/oz, but most quart size kits costs about a buck an ounce).
This kit was 35 oz total, with a lot of extras, for only $0.70/oz. Even if you don't need the glitter, etc, just the gloves, measuring cups, etc is worth getting. You probably don't have those things, and you'll need them.
Just be careful on the measurements. They have ounces marked clear enough, but on the back, they seem to have centimeters and millimeters intermixed, and I wouldn't trust those, unless you know what you're doing. The lines are very fine, so I literally drew over the ounce marks I wanted to use with a sharpie, to ensure I didn't mess up.
Mixing the two parts equally is a big deal, so it matters.
